In cross-fostering studies, the young of one species are placed in the care of adults from another species. in broad terms, what
Bess [88]
These sorts of studies can help researchers determine the relative importance of nurture and nature in determining a trait. Nature here would refer to genetics passed down to an individual from its parents, whereas nurture refers to the environment the individual is exposed to.
